First Yard Line fruit Salad with Tequila and Lime
Syrup: 
3/4 cup sugar 
1/4 cup water 
1/4 cup fresh lime juice 
2 to 3 Tblsp. tequila 
Salad:
3 cups fresh pineapple chunks 
2 pints fresh strawberries, halved 
1/2 lb. green seedless grapes 
2 pink grapefruits, sectioned 
2 navel oranges, sectioned 
4 kiwis, peeled and cut into chunks 
2 ripe mangoes, peeld and cut into chunks 
1 tsp. grated lime peel 
 
Make syrup: Bring sugar and water to a boil in a small saucepan.  Reduce heat and simmer until sugar dissolves,about 2 minutes.  
Remove from heat and stir in lime juice and tequila.  
Cool to room temperature, cover and refrigerate 2 hours, until cold. 
Meanwhile, combine pineapple, strawberries, grapes, grapefruit, oranges, kiwis, and mangoes in a large serving
bowl; stir gently to combine. 
Can be made ahead; refrigerate up to 2 hours.  Just before serving, stir lime peel into syrup, and drizzle syrup over fruit. 
Makes 10 servings. (12 cups).
